When I first encountered the term “sustainable building,” visions of expansive eco-villages and cutting-edge structures reminiscent of a sci-fi film danced in my mind. Yet, I soon realized that sustainable building is far more practical and doable than I initially imagined. At its core, it involves designing and constructing homes with the aim of minimizing environmental impact while maximizing energy efficiency and comfort. The overarching goal is to create living spaces that fulfill our current needs without jeopardizing the resources available for future generations.
